AWARD RECIPIENTS AT QUEEN'S PARK, TORONTO Mr. Haroon Siddiqui, Editorial Page Editor Emeritus of the Toronto Star, was the award recipient in January 2001, at Eid-ul-Fitr Celebrations at Queen's Park, Toronto. He was recognized for his “Outstanding work on National and International matters and courageous stand on Islamic issues”.

The Toronto Star, the largest daily newspaper in Canada, was the recipient of the Fitr Award for its “Fair and balanced reporting on National and International issues, and for its vigilance against racism, for its constant advocacy of Fairness & Equality, and for being the real voice for all Canadians”. Publisher, John A. Honderich received the award on behalf of the paper.
His Excellency, Dr. Mohammad A. Mousavi, Ambassador of the Islamic Republic of Iran, was the Keynote Speaker.

Honourable R. Roy McMurtry, the Chief Justice of Ontario, was the Keynote Speaker and Award Recipient at the sixth annual celebration on December 13, 2002,. He was recognized for his: "Distinguished career in Public Service with exceptional dedication to Justice and Equality for all Canadians, his courageous stand on Human Rights issues, and his understanding and friendship for Muslims, particularly Canadian Muslims".

Honourable Senator Vivienne Poy, also the Chancellor of the University of Toronto, was the Keynote Speaker and award recipient at the 9th Eid-ul-Fitr celebrations on December 9, 2005. The Association paid tribute to her for her "OUTSTANDING COMMUNITY SERVICE AND ACHIEVEMENTS AS A BUSINESS WOMAN, SENATOR AND CHANCELLOR OF THE UNIVERSITY OF TORONTO, HER WORK AS AN ADVOCATE FOR VISIBLE MINORITIES AND IMMIGRANT COMMUNITIES, AND FOR PROMOTING GREATER UNDERSTANDING OF ASIAN CANADIAN CONTRIBUTIONS ACROSS CANADA DURING ASIAN HERITAGE MONTH IN MAY”.

For story and photos, please click here. ******************************************************* 16TH ANNUAL EID-UL-FITR CELEBRATIONS - QUEEN'S PARK SEPTEMBER 10, 2012 The celebrations were held in the Main Legislative Building, Room 230, 2nd Floor. This time, instead of a dinner, it was a luncheon from 11:30 A.M. till 1:30 P.M. Several Members of Provincial Parliament attended. as the event was held during the lunch break for the House. Premier Dalton McGuinty was represented by Hon. Kathleen Wynne who brought greetings from the Ontario Liberal Party, Hon. Tim Hudak, Leader of the Ontario Progressive Conservative Party ( Official Opposition) and Hon. Andrea Horwath, Leader of the Ontario New Democrats brought greetings from their parties. As of 2012, since we started having luncheons, we stopped giving awards due to time constraints
